I hope this image drives global attention to end the grindadr\u00e1p and, at a broader scale, advocates for a reconsideration of what the human relationship with others living beings should be.\u201d <a href=\"https:\/\/petapixel.com\/2025\/08\/15\/the-awe-inspiring-finalists-for-ocean-photographer-of-the-year-2025\/c-youenn-kerdavid-2\/\" rel=\"attachment wp-att-810008 nofollow noopener\" data-wpel-link=\"internal\" target=\"_blank\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/www.newsbeep.com\/au\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/08\/c-Youenn-Kerdavid-1-800x534.jpg\" alt=\"A large ship uses a crane to lift a whale's tail from the water in a cold, icy sea with snow-covered mountains in the background.\" width=\"800\" height=\"534\" class=\"size-large wp-image-810008\"  \/><\/a>Youenn Kerdavid \/ Ocean Photographer of the Year<br \/>\u201cOver the past 20 years, krill fishing has quadrupled,\u201d says Kerdavid, \u201cmainly to produce non-essential products like Omega-3 supplements, pet food, and feed for farmed salmon \u2013 used to make the flesh pink for Western supermarkets. A single trawler can catch up to 500 tonnes of krill per day. That\u2019s enough to feed 150 whales. Less krill means less food for whales, seals, penguins, and countless other species. Today, krill extraction is one of the fastest-growing threats to Antarctic wildlife. To this day, this remains the most incredible wildlife interaction I have ever had.\u201d <a href=\"https:\/\/petapixel.com\/2025\/08\/15\/the-awe-inspiring-finalists-for-ocean-photographer-of-the-year-2025\/c-sirachai-arunrugstichai\/\" rel=\"attachment wp-att-810017 nofollow noopener\" data-wpel-link=\"internal\" target=\"_blank\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/www.newsbeep.com\/au\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/08\/c-Sirachai-Arunrugstichai-800x534.jpg\" alt=\"A fisherman on a boat at night holds a flaming torch over the water, attracting and illuminating a swarm of fish while another person stands nearby; splashing water and fish are visible in the darkness.\" width=\"800\" height=\"534\" class=\"size-large wp-image-810017\"  \/><\/a>Sirachai Arunrugstichai \/ Ocean Photographer of the Year<br \/>\u201cFuji 268, one of Taiwan\u2019s last fire fishing boats, ignites a fireball to startle sardines in the coastal waters of New Taipei,\u201d says Arunrugstichai. \u201cBy 2023, it was the sole survivor of this national cultural heritage of Taiwan, with the crew working to sustain the tradition by partnering with local guides and launching their own educational program to offset costs and dwindling fish stocks. The effort drew more than 5,000 tourists in 2024 \u2013 double the previous year \u2013 sparking enough demand for another fire fishing boat to return to operation under this growing business model.\u201d <a href=\"https:\/\/petapixel.com\/2025\/08\/15\/the-awe-inspiring-finalists-for-ocean-photographer-of-the-year-2025\/c-yifan-ling-2\/\" rel=\"attachment wp-att-810018 nofollow noopener\" data-wpel-link=\"internal\" target=\"_blank\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/www.newsbeep.com\/au\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/08\/c-Yifan-Ling-2-800x450.jpg\" alt=\"A large orca breaches dramatically close to shore, creating a splash in the water, while two people on a sandy beach photograph the whale with cameras.
